Refined Grains And Their Health Risks

Refined grains are stripped of their bran and germ layers during processing, removing valuable nutrients like fiber, vitamins, and minerals. What remains is a starchy endosperm that’s quickly digested, leading to spikes in blood sugar levels. This rapid increase can contribute to weight gain, insulin resistance, and an increased risk of type 2 diabetes. Additionally, refined grains lack the satiety and digestive benefits of their whole grain counterparts, potentially leading to overeating and digestive issues.

Moreover, refined grains often undergo chemical treatments and bleaching processes to improve texture and appearance, which can introduce harmful additives and reduce overall nutritional quality. Regular consumption of refined grains has been associated with inflammation in the body, which is linked to various chronic diseases such as heart disease and certain types of cancer. Opting for whole grains instead of refined ones can provide essential nutrients and fiber while supporting better overall health and well-being.

Gluten-Containing Grains And Sensitivities

Many individuals experience sensitivities or intolerances to gluten, which is a protein found in certain grains. Gluten-containing grains such as wheat, barley, and rye are known to trigger adverse reactions in people with celiac disease or non-celiac gluten sensitivity. These grains can lead to digestive issues, inflammation, fatigue, and other symptoms in susceptible individuals.

The consumption of gluten-containing grains can also contribute to long-term health problems for those with sensitivities. Over time, repeated exposure to gluten may damage the lining of the intestines, leading to nutrient malabsorption and autoimmune responses. It is crucial for individuals with gluten sensitivities to avoid grains like wheat, barley, and rye to prevent negative health effects and improve overall wellbeing.

By identifying and eliminating gluten-containing grains from their diet, individuals with sensitivities can experience relief from symptoms and support their bodies in healing. Opting for alternative grains like quinoa, rice, millet, and amaranth can provide nutrient-rich options that are well-tolerated and support optimal health for those with gluten sensitivities.

Phytic Acid In Grains And Nutrient Absorption

Phytic acid is a naturally occurring compound found in grains that can hinder the absorption of essential nutrients in the body. When consumed in high amounts, phytic acid can bind to minerals like iron, zinc, calcium, and magnesium, preventing their absorption in the gastrointestinal tract. This can lead to nutrient deficiencies over time, impacting overall health and wellbeing.

To reduce the negative effects of phytic acid on nutrient absorption, there are several methods that can be utilized. One common practice is soaking, sprouting, or fermenting grains before consumption, which can help reduce the phytic acid content and improve mineral bioavailability. Additionally, consuming foods high in vitamin C and other organic acids alongside phytic acid-containing grains can enhance mineral absorption by counteracting the inhibitory effects of phytic acid.

By being aware of the presence of phytic acid in grains and its impact on nutrient absorption, individuals can make informed choices about their diet to optimize nutrient intake and promote better overall health. Incorporating strategies to mitigate the effects of phytic acid can ensure that essential minerals are absorbed effectively, supporting optimal health and wellbeing.
